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, SITTING DROP | 293 | Reservoir contained 0.2 M sodium formate and 20% (w/v) PEG 3350. Enzyme solution contained 20 mM 1-hydroxyethane-1-sulfonate. Crystal was soaked in cryobuffer containing 20% PEG 200 and 20 mM 1-hydroxyethane-1-sulfonate |
